Take a breather in Jamestown, ND, a charming town known for its rich history and unique attractions. Catch your bus to Jamestown and step into the past at Frontier Village, a delightful homage to pioneer days complete with historic buildings and artifacts. Don’t miss out on the world’s largest buffalo statue, Dakota Thunder, offering a quirky photo-op you’ll want to share.
Animal lovers will enjoy the National Buffalo Museum, which includes a live herd where you might spot White Cloud, a rare albino bison. Prefer a little indoor intrigue? The Stutsman County Memorial Museum hosts an array of exhibits showcasing the area’s storied past.
After soaking in history, recharge with a visit to the local coffee shops and eateries, where friendly faces and comforting flavors create a cozy atmosphere. Outdoor enthusiasts can stretch their legs at the serene Jamestown Reservoir, perfect for hiking and bird-watching.
